DescriptionJOB DESCRIPTION:
PHARMACY MANAGER
DEPARTMENT: Pharmacy
REPORTS TO: Regional VP, Operations
FLSA STATUS: Exempt
QualificationsEducation: Graduate of an accredited college of pharmacy. Pharm
D is preferred. Licensed to practice pharmacy in the state of employment. An Active/Unrestricted Texas Pharmacist license is required.
Experience: Three years retail pharmacy experience. One-year managerial experience preferred.
Knowledge, Skills and Abilities:
- Knowledge of best practices in field.
- Comprehensive knowledge of pharmaceuticals, their indications, interactions, and potential side effects.
- Skill in the development of drug therapies.
- Knowledge of relevant accreditation and certification requirements.
- Ability to establish goals, structures, and processes necessary to implement a mission and strategic vision.
- Leadership, coaching, and teambuilding skills, to strengthen and cultivate relationships.
- Strategic and analytical thinking skills with an ability to solve problems and make decisions.
- Ability to network and interact, as well as support effective partnerships with key groups and individuals.
- Ability to prioritize ongoing and new projects, as well as conduct research and gather information.
- Consultation and change management skills.
- Verbal/written communication, presentation, and interpersonal skills.
- Bilingual Spanish is highly preferred.
JOB SUMMARY
Directs and coordinates all pharmacy activities, including clinical services, performance improvement, dispensing, and the purchasing, receipt and storage of pharmaceuticals. Collaborates with upper level management in order to ensure the deliverance of high quality pharmacy services and safe, effective, and appropriate medication treatment.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S (This document in no way states or implies that these are the only duties to be performed by the employee occupying this position):
- Ensure the pharmacy provides optimal service, meets legal and accreditation/certification requirements, and complies with all policies and standards of Maxor National Pharmacy Services Corporation.
- Maintain daily operation of pharmacy department by supervising pharmacists and pharmacy technicians in the routine performance of their duties.
- Ensure the pharmacy is adequately staffed during all hours of operation.
- Schedule pharmacy staff for routine, weekend, holiday, and on-call hours.
- Provide appropriate technical and customer service training for pharmacy staff.
- Review and update established drug-therapy guidelines and other policies and procedures for use by physicians, nurses, and pharmacists.
- Provide drug information to meet the needs of physicians and nurses through direct contact or in-service programs.
- Prepare various reports and maintain records or supervise the maintenance of records as required or requested by the Regional Vice President.
- Maintain current knowledge of drug therapies and drug reactions and interactions by reading professional literature, attending seminars and utilizing professional affiliations.
- Monitor drug therapy for contraindications, interactions, allergies, and appropriateness.
- Provide patient information and counseling.
- Interpret and fill drug orders.
- Compound, prepare I.V. admixtures (if applicable), and dispense prescriptions.
- Participate in inventory control programs such as ordering, inventorying, and monitoring as required by the Regional Vice President.
- Work Inventory Reports to maintain inventory and turns.
- Participate in activities resolving unsafe and unsanitary practices.
- Attend and participate in other programs, committees, meetings, and functions required by the pharmacy department.
- Contact and confer with physicians regarding questions or irregularities on prescriptions.
- Maintain inventory and records of controlled drugs and other drugs as required by law.
- Ensure the delivery of positive customer service and follow up on customer complaints.
- Work cooperatively with other staff members to enhance the team concept.
